(-)-beta-caryophyllene is a beta-caryophyllene in which the stereocentre adjacent to the exocyclic double bond has S configuration while the remaining stereocentre has R configuration. It is the most commonly occurring form of beta-caryophyllene, occurring in many essential oils, particularly oil of cloves. It has a role as an insect attractant, a metabolite, a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ug and a fragrance. It is an enantiomer of a (+)-beta-caryophyllene.

| Molecular formula | C15H24 |
|---|---|
| Molecular weight | 204.35 g/mol |
| IUPAC name | (1R,4E,9S)-4,11,11-trimethyl-8-methylidenebicyclo[7.2.0]undec-4-ene |
| InChIKey | NPNUFJAVOOONJE-GFUGXAQUSA-N |
| SMILES | C/C/1=C\CCC(=C)[C@H]2CC([C@@H]2CC1)(C)C |
